What it does
What
Education/trainingArts/culture/heritage/scienceWho
The General Public/mankindHow
Provides ServicesCharitable objects
TO PROMOTE, IMPROVE, DEVELOP AND MAINTAIN PUBLIC EDUCATION IN AND APPRECIATION OF THE ART AND SCIENCE OF MUSIC IN ALL ITS ASPECTS BY THE PRESENTATION OF PUBLIC CONCERTS AND RECITALS AND BY SUCH OTHER WAYS AS THE SOCIETY THROUGH ITS COMMITTEE SHALL DETERMINE FROM TIME TO TIME.
Governing document: CONSTITUTION ADOPTED 3 DECEMBER 1993 AS AMENDED 8 JULY 1994
